By Fr. Joseph Thanh, SDB

Araimiri, PNG, 12, June 2017 -- During the past weeks, the Mary Help of Christians Parish Araimiri joyfully and gratefully welcomed a significant number of newly baptized in the parish. They are total of 55, young and old, received the Sacrament of Baptism in different communities of the parish. Perhaps nowadays the numbers of baptism are no longer a crucial factor in the mission of the Church as used to practice in the past but it is always a radical way of evangelization and for the mission like Araimiri.


Maybe this number of newly baptized is nothing compared to other places but it is a great blessing to this mission parish. Araimiri is the most remote and isolated mission of the PGS Vice Province. The people in this mission area are suffering a lot in different aspects of life such as very low education level, very poor economic development and very relaxing in practicing their Christian faith. In fact It is quite hard to find a person to read the readings in the Mass properly. All of these also lead to the poor attitude and behavior among the villagers.


However, the mercy of God through the Sacred Heart of Jesus always shows his love in abundance. Among so many challenges, difficulties and hopelessness; the goodness and hope of our good Lord always present. The newly baptized number shows that God is still present here and the people still go to him, search for him and need him. Thus the mission and evangelization are always needed.
